For this modern revisitation of the seat designed by Pierre Paulin in 1967 for the galleries of the Louvre museum, La Cividina has used 1970s manufacturing techniques.

areas
Whether making statement as a sculptural seat in residential settings or accommodating high traffic contract markets such as art galleries or hotels, Dos à Dos is a timeless seating solution.

configuration
Covered with seamless stretch fabric in a chic various hues, the clover-shaped tubular steel structure is reinforced with elastic webbing and multi-density memory foam padding to ensure a sturdy yet flexible frame.
